2063 Siesta Dr, Sarasota, FL 34239Vino-Vino Italian Restaurant in Sarasota has been inspected 22 times since January 2022, accumulating 69 violations—an average of 3.1 per inspection, below the statewide average of 5.2. The facility has never been emergency-closed. Hand washing and employee health violations have been recurring concerns, cited across multiple inspections including February 2025 and September 2024. The most recent inspection on March 31, 2026 found 4 basic violations involving food contact surfaces and chemical storage, resulting in no further action required.
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
